Transaction 15695d66fa7434be7915c6cf1d8fc98db6565174b3855f8fa46b8fc7a877b3a3
3 Input
2 Outputs
- 15695d66fa7434be7915c6cf1d8fc98db6565174b3855f8fa46b8fc7a877b3a3:0
- 15695d66fa7434be7915c6cf1d8fc98db6565174b3855f8fa46b8fc7a877b3a3:1
value 636943
address 134aDSgd2kAQPF5iNkFDm6xBupuUCZvX1f
value 8000000
address 1AhbpXvPiCrM74HmWwVqYb3SDqS3FuX5e8